- The distance between Tebessa, Algeria and Unzendake, Japan is approximately 10,335 km or 6,423 mi.
- To reach Tebessa in this distance one would set out from Unzendake bearing 316.3°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Tebessa bearing 225.5° or SW .
- Tebessa has a mid-latitude cool steppe climate (BSk) whereas Unzendake has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- The mean annual temperature is 2.6 °C (4.7°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 2 °C (3.6°F) less in Tebessa. The continentality subtype is semicontinental as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 2676.2 mm (105.4 in) less which is equivalent to 2676.2 l/m² (65.68 US gal/ft²) or 26,762,000 l/ha (2,861,035 US gal/ac) less. About 1/9 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 2.7° lower in Tebessa than in Unzendake.
